But if allosteric inhibitors cause some … bangkok in juneWebIn non-competitive reversible inhibition, the inhibitor does not compete with the substrate for the active site. It binds to a different region of the enzyme. Non-competitive inhibitors have identical affinities for E and ES. They do not change Km, but decreases Vmax.
